The reasons behind the BBC decision

Grandstand producer Belinda Rogerson explained the BBC’s decision to drop live WSB this Sunday. She Said: " Unfortunately, the scheduled date for the 1st round in Valencia was moved from March 9 to March 2 late in 2002. We had planned to show both of the races during the day on BBC TWO on March 9, however the schedule of sport that we were already committed to showing on March 2, including Rugby...
